Job Description

Omni Amelia Island is looking for an Assistant Director of Human Resources to join the Human Resources Team!

The Assistant Director of Human Resources will assist the Director of Human Resources in overseeing all HR to include Employee Relations, Recruitment, International Workers, Benefits and Training.  

Responsibilities

  • In the absence of the HRD, assume the responsibilities of the HRD role.
  • Maintain ASC and Omni Standards at all times.
  • Partner and Mentor Human Resources Manager and Recruitment Managers
  • Directly oversee the HR LID and ASC Office Coordinator.
  • Take ownership of payroll by auditing overtime, Kronos and PTO for the department.
  • Input Secondary Job Codes weekly to insure proper processing of Payroll.
  • Audit and correct Zero Pay Rate report.
  • Audit Wage Analysis monthly.
  • Maintain files for Independent Contractors and Temporary Staffing Agencies.
  • Monitor departmental expense in compliance with check-book accounting process.  Work closely to ensure Associate Relations and Recruitment expenses are in line with monthly budget.
  • Participate in yearly budgeting process and forecasting with HRD
  • Oversee all aspects of international recruitment (Selection, Onboarding, Housing, Employee Shuttle, Training Plans, Appreciation Evens and Employee Relations)
